This is from a few years ago, but still three great reiner/cow horses doing their thing at a high level while being over 20 years old. There are many more out there today.

http://americashorsedaily.com/age-is-ju ... tb4v_znbcs

I have a real soft spot for the old timers. A few years ago, there was a racing QH in OK still winning stakes at 16-17 years old! They would bring him out and race him 1-3 times per year, and he'd win 'em, bring home $20-30,000. Can you imagine? He was retired as soon as he lost 2 races in a row (neither by much, mind you).

Hadji Halef Omar is a purebred Arabian endurance horse who has logged 8,575 lifetime miles over 170 American Endurance Ride Conference (AERC) rides


We rode competitive trail rides against a horse named Elmer Bandit

In September 2009 owner Mary Anna Wood and Elmer completed the Stephens Forest Competitive Trail event near Lucas, Iowa, which pushed Elmer’s lifetime mileage to 20,780 miles, surpassing the previous record held by Wing Tempo (an American Saddlebred who said they just look flashy and go in circles) ).

Elmer won numerous National Championships over his 34-year career... he was 37 when he did the Stephens Forest Competitive Trail ... he died the following winter
